Redblacks QB Trevor Harris will be out “a matter of weeks”

Ottawa quarterback Trevor Harris will be out a “matter of weeks” according to head coach Rick Campbell.

He told TSN 1200 in Ottawa that it’s not a devastating injury, but it’s going to be about how fast his body reacts – the right throwing shoulder is bruised.

Harris took a big hit from Ticats defensive lineman Davon Coleman on Saturday and that forced him from the game.

Backup Drew Tate came in, but he could not lead the Redblacks to a comeback win as Ottawa fell 26-22.
